In Winter

It is winter here Leaves are filling in the space Looking for some grace **** The sun meets the tree Seeks a warm hug from its bough It comes back empty **** Just the other day Found the tree merrymaking Now moans in dismay **** Trees sigh in the wind Reality is so hard Trampled are the birds **** The crushed time moves on The chocolate will return Let’s smile for the dawn _________________________
